Capital is visibly rewarding scale and integration in real estate technology — four scale mergers closed or announced within roughly a year (Rocket-Redfin, CoStar-Matterport, Compass-Anywhere, RE/MAX-Real Brokerage) — while the court-approved NAR commission settlement permanently restructures commission economics in favor of well-capitalized platforms, but this is a crowded late-cycle re-rating on a still-fragile housing volume base: 2026 mortgage-rate forecasts diverge by over 50bp, Compass is carrying $3.1bn of new debt, and CoStar is still subsidizing Homes.com by hundreds of millions of dollars a year with no EBITDA breakeven before 2030.
